Bristol Mind Our VisionOur vision is to support everyone in and around Bristol in achieving the best mental health possibleOur MissionOur mission uses the power of our local community to create inclusive services based on lived experience:Our Mindline and Infoline services are volunteer-led and provide the first steps to finding the right support.Our Community Wellbeing services focus on minoritised groups and prioritise co-production and leadership.Our Meeting Minds Counselling includes tailored LGBTQIA+, Neurodivergent and 18-25 provision.Our Workplace Wellbeing offer includes bespoke training and consultancy for local businesses, proceeds directly fund our services.Bristol Mind offers services to adults in Bristol and South Gloucestershire aged 18 and over. We believe that mental health and wellbeing services should be timely, inclusive and accessible to everyone in our community. This means listening to you, involving you and learning alongside you about what is needed, and how we can best respond.
